Leonardo Delivers 1,000th AW139
Leonardo is confident it can go on to deliver 2,000 or even 3,000 AW139s even as competitors target the aircraft with their latest designs.
Italy's Guardia di Finanza took delivery of the 1,000th copy of the AW139, and manufacturer Leondardo sees a strong market for the model in both civil and military applications. (Photo: Ian Sheppard)
